1. Perform the execution of the following pseudocode with the array A= [8,0,2,1,9,3] INSERTION-SORT(A) 1 for...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
1. Perform the execution of the following pseudocode with the array A= [8,0,2,1,9,3] INSERTION-SORT(A) 1 for j2 to length[A] do key A[j] 12345678 Insert A[j] into the sorted sequence A[1.. j - 1]. i- j-1 while i 0 and A[i]> key do A[i+1] A[i] i-i-1 A[i+1] key Loop invariants and the correctness of insertion sort 2. Is the number of executions of the line 5 the same for all the iterations of the for loop? 3. For a given iteration of the loop for, can we know exactly the number of iterations of the loop while (line 5) ? 4. In general, consider any loop: what is the relation between the number of execution of the loop header and that loop body. 5. For the pseudocode above, compute the running time T(n) where n is the size of the A 6. What is the best case? what is its running time? 7. What is the worst case? what is its running time? 1. Perform the execution of the following pseudocode with the array A= [8,0,2,1,9,3] INSERTION-SORT(A) 1 for j2 to length[A] do key A[j] 12345678 Insert A[j] into the sorted sequence A[1.. j - 1]. i- j-1 while i 0 and A[i]> key do A[i+1] A[i] i-i-1 A[i+1] key Loop invariants and the correctness of insertion sort 2. Is the number of executions of the line 5 the same for all the iterations of the for loop? 3. For a given iteration of the loop for, can we know exactly the number of iterations of the loop while (line 5) ? 4. In general, consider any loop: what is the relation between the number of execution of the loop header and that loop body. 5. For the pseudocode above, compute the running time T(n) where n is the size of the A 6. What is the best case? what is its running time? 7. What is the worst case? what is its running time?
Expert Answer:
Related Book For
Introduction to Algorithms
ISBN: 978-0262033848
3rd edition
Authors: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est
Posted Date:
Students also viewed these computer network questions
-
Let n E N. n 23. In Exercise 2.67 and Definition 2.65, the dihedral groups are defined as the group of rigid motions of a regular n-gon. The following figures represent such a polygon form odd and...
-
Let A, B be sets. Define: (a) the Cartesian product (A B) (b) the set of relations R between A and B (c) the identity relation A on the set A [3 marks] Suppose S, T are relations between A and B, and...
-
A person is pulling on a rope attached to a locomotive of mass m = 100 tons (Fig. 1, right). The person is pulling with a constant force F that is 2 times greater than their body weight, at an upward...
-
What is open-source software? What is the biggest stumbling block with the use of open-source software?
-
Find a recent sustainability report. Good reports can be found at the Australian Reporting Awards website; however, it might be useful to compare these to other firms reports. Required Prepare a...
-
What is a say-on-pay vote?
-
Moss Exports is having a bad year. Net income is only $60,000. Also, two important overseas customers are falling behind in their payments to Moss, and Mosss accounts receivable are ballooning. The...
-
18 years ago, I purchased 185 shares of a stock worth $14.25 per share. There was a 2:1 split, a 4:1 split, and a 3:1 split during that time period. Today the stock is worth $1.53 per share. If the...
-
The Ortega Food Company needs to ship 100 cases of hot tamales from its warehouse in San Diego to a distributor in New York City at minimum cost. The costs associated with shipping 100 cases between...
-
swered t of estion B nswered ut of question How will you make all paragraph elements 'Red' in color? Select one: O O O O a. p {color: red;} b. p.all (color: red;} c. all.p (color: #998877;} d. p.all...
-
Given a Cobb-Douglas production function Q (L, K) = 10.00L0.600K0.500 where L is labor (i.e. workers) and K is capital (i.e. machinery, tools) (A) (5 Points) Please fill in the empty 7x7 matrix cells...
-
Our department needs a new copier, and your job is to research the options. Based on your research, you have selected an all-in-one machine that you believe will be cost effective and will perform...
-
Draft a paragraph for each question's answers: Question 1 : Explain three benefits of inclusion to a person who believes that all special needs students should be educated exclusively in a special...
-
In a survey of 206 investors, it was observed that only 10 employees owned shares of the company, 30 owned only securities and 140 owned bonds. In addition, 26 owned shares and securities; 46 had...
-
The following diagram shows the Gint coefficient and income share of the B40. M40 and T20 groups in Malaysia between the years 1970 and 2019. Income Share (%) 70.0 60.0 55.7 50.0 40.0 30.0 20.0 10.0...
-
If y=tan (20) x =sec(20) Determine (i) at 0 = = (ii) dx 6 dx
-
If the jobs displayed in Table 18.24 are processed using the earliestdue-date rule, what would be the lateness of job C? TABLE 18.24 Processing Times and Due Dates for Five Jobs Job C D E...
-
Let G = (V, E) be a directed graph with weight function w : E R, and let n = |V|. We define the mean weight of a cycle c = e 1 , e 2 , . . . , e k of edges in E to be Let * = min c (c), where c...
-
Show that if p is prime and e is a positive integer, then (p e ) = p e 1 (p 1).
-
When RANDOMIZED-QUICKSORT runs, how many calls are made to the random number generator RANDOM in the worst case? How about in the best case? Give your answer in terms of -notation.
-
If \(X\) is a positive random variable, prove that its negative moments are given by, for \(r>0\) : (a) \(\quad \mathbb{E}\left(X^{-r} ight)=\frac{1}{\Gamma(r)} \int_{0}^{\infty} t^{r-1}...
-
Let \(X \stackrel{\text { law }}{=} \mathcal{N}\left(m, \sigma^{2} ight)\) and \(\lambda>0\). Prove that \[\mathbb{E}\left(e^{-\lambda X^{2}} ight)=\frac{1}{\sqrt{1+2 \lambda \sigma^{2}}} \exp...
-
One might naively think that a collection \(\left(X_{t}, t \in \mathbb{R}^{+} ight)\)of independent r.v's may be chosen "measurably," i.e., with the map \[\left(\mathbb{R}^{+} \times \Omega,...
Study smarter with the SolutionInn App